How much is an Australian tourist visa?

Visitor visas summary

VisaHow to applyCost
Electronic Travel Authority (ETA)Online here$20
Visitor visa (subclass 600)Online (account required)$145 – $1,065 (depending on circumstances)
eVisitor visa (subclass 651)Online here (account required)Free

What tourist visa do I need for Australia?

Visitor visa (subclass 600) The Visitor visa is designed for people who are not eligible for the eVisitor or Electronic Travel Authority visa. This visa allows you to visit Australia, either for tourism or business purposes, for three, six or 12 months. Applicants will have to pay a fee to submit their application.

How long is a tourist visa in Australia?

6 months
Australian Tourist visa for up to 6 months stay: What is permitted? Your 6 month tourist visa is valid for 12 months from the date it is issued. The visa allows for multiple visits, i.e. you will be permitted to leave and re-enter Australia as frequently as you like during this 12 month period.

Can I change my visitor visa to work visa in Australia?

Once you hold a visitor visa, you cannot extend it or convert it into another type of visa, such as a working visa. Many people can meet requirements only for Visitor visa Subclass 600. If they apply for this type of visa while they are outside of Australia, visa application charge (VAC) is $140.

What is Type D visa?

National Visas (Type D) allow the visa holder to enter and stay in Germany continuously more than 90 days. National visas also allow visa holders to transit in other Schengen countries.

Can I travel outside Australia with a visa with condition 8501?

In some circumstances, we might grant your visa with Condition 8501 – Maintain adequate health insurance. Check if you have multiple entry, or single entry, in VEVO or your visa grant letter. If you have multiple entry, you can travel outside Australia and return while your visa is valid.
